VBA (Visual Basic for Applications) is a sophisticated programming language that lets users to write small-scale procedures that are referred to as macros which can be automated and optimized Excel spreadsheets.
A thorough understanding of Visual Basic for Applications will make you stand out and increase your employability in the business world.
excel vba course london will teach you how to do that with a gradual, fun way that will have you working with these tools quickly and also in the spreadsheets you use frequently.
The basics of VBA
Excel VBA Course London is Microsoft’s internal code language, which can be tailored to meet business requirements or to automate repetitive tasks.
VBA is comprised of three major components, namely objects, procedures and definitions. Macros consist of user-written instructions for processing data in order to automate repetitive actions.
Objects, made up of code, are composed of properties and a method that are designed to take and carry out commands, finish jobs and carry out other tasks. Examples include the application itself, worksheets, workbooks, sheets chart, ranges of cells, and forms.
Functions
VBA is an operating system that allows you to automate a variety of Excel tasks, such as creating charts, graphs and reports and calculations.
Excel functions are crucial to the programming process. They can increase the efficiency of of your work. For instance, Functions can allow the automatic refresh of a pivot table when connecting to an external data source.
Sub-Procedures
Sub-procedures can be described as pieces of Excel VBA course London code that you can run using macros. Similar to functions and sub procedures need one argument to return the output value.
Sub-procedures are executed in various ways. Sub-procedures can be invoked directly from Visual Basic Editor.
Create sub-procedures using buttons or shapes into your workbook. This will result in the Macro Dialog box, where you are able to select and execute the desired Macro.
Variables
Variables in VBA are shorthand terms for cells that store value and can be used in many ways to show these values. Excel variables are an integral component of programming and they're a great tool for professionals who work using equations or numbers.
Variables can be assigned values using variable declarations and assignment statements. These are different from the declarations of data types in VBA.
Loops

Loops are a useful tool that allows you to repeat actions (such for changing the value in cells) for an infinite number of loops.
While they can be difficult to operate, loops are extremely useful for repetitive tasks.
For loops can be used to execute actions on different objects within Excel like tables, cells as well as pivot fields. They can also be used to loop through a series of numbers.
The following are some examples of events you can attend
When an VBA program is running there are many things happening simultaneously. This includes variables as well as subprocedures being invoked as well macros.
Excel VBA courses will show you how to respond to events by using VBA codes. This can automate workflows and reduce the amount of work to be done that will help increase productivity.
It will save you time by understanding the right syntax of VBA. You'll be able take your knowledge to the next level!